Hi Dan

In case the rather shorthand answers have still left things unclear,
the system is working correctly for Gear and Spoiler Warnings
active.

In most ships you don't want to roll with spoilers open, so
have that warning active. Spoilers open, gear down, no
airspeed is a warning and SPOILERS will show on the screen.
For LS8/ASW24 or whatever where you want to roll with them
open until you have good roll control, disable the warning.

You will still get a warning (with Gear Warning enabled) if
you open spoilers with gear up. You can test the spoiler
warning function is correct by pressurising pitot to
50 knots, opening the spoilers should then give no warning
unless the gear is up.
